What the part must do in the assembly

An enclosure may be installed in a cabinet, outdoor housing or communication module, and each environment changes the design priorities.

Design rules that affect castability

Design areaRisk if ignoredBetter engineering action
thermal pathheat remains inside enclosurereview heat sink areas and contact faces
connector openingsburrs, poor alignment or coating interferencemachine and inspect functional openings
sealing facewater or dust ingressdefine flatness and gasket surface
surface coatingcorrosion or blocked contact areaconfirm coating and masking plan

Communication enclosures combine mechanical and thermal requirements

A communication equipment casting may need connector alignment, heat dissipation, shielding and outdoor coating in one part. These requirements can conflict. For example, a coated surface may protect against corrosion, but a grounding area may need to remain conductive. A heat path may need machining, while other faces can remain as-cast.

FunctionDesign implicationProduction check
Thermal transferFlat contact face or finsFlatness and machining marks.
Connector fitAccurate openingsCNC machining and deburring.
Shielding or groundingNo-coating contact zonesMasking and continuity check.

RFQ recommendation

Provide PCB location, connector drawings and finishing requirements together. Without this information, the supplier may quote a casting that is dimensionally correct but difficult to assemble.
